Hailey Merkt, a former contestant on *The Bachelor*, has died at 31 after a long battle with leukemia. A message posted on her Instagram confirmed her passing, saying, “It is with broken hearts we share that our beloved Hailey has passed away after a courageous fight for her life.”

Hailey was remembered for her bravery and determination. “She chose to spend her last moments with family and friends doing what she loved most, with no regrets,” the post said, describing her as “highly entertaining, never dull, and fully present in the present moment.”

Her former *Bachelor* co-stars shared their grief online. “I feel so lucky to know your laugh,” Danielle Maltby wrote. Raven Gates added, “You’ll be remembered always,” while Dominique Alexis expressed, “I can’t believe I won’t see you again, but I’ll treasure every memory.”

Hailey’s journey had ups and downs. In April, she celebrated being “leukemia free,” but sadly, the cancer returned within weeks. Her GoFundMe page, set up by grieving family members, revealed, “Her first reaction was to say, ‘I don’t care about myself anymore, but I can’t bear being the cause of so much pain for the people I love.’

Hailey first appeared on Season 21 of *The Bachelor*, competing for Nick Viall’s heart before being eliminated in the second week.
